How much do property management ass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 25, 2026, the average hourly pay for property management assistant in Springfield, MA is $21.72,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.74 and $24.18 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a property management assistant?

Property Management Assistants support property managers in handling the daily operations of residential, commercial, or industrial properties. Their responsibilities often include communicating with tenants, scheduling maintenance, processing rent payments, and assisting with leasing paperwork. They help ensure that properties are well-maintained and that tenant needs are addressed promptly. This role requires strong organizational, communication, and problem-solving skills.

What does a property management assistant do?

The job duties of a property management assistant include overseeing maintenance and repairs and handling administrative responsibilities for an apartment complex or housing community. In this career, you assist the property manager with the general upkeep of the residential units and provide any necessary services for tenants. As an assistant member of the property management team, you may often communicate directly with tenants to answer questions and assess their needs. You may also work on marketing and tenant retention, and collect essential documentation for leasing agreements.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a property management ass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Property Management Assistant,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a basic understanding of property management procedures, often supported by a high school diploma or relevant coursework. Familiarity with property management software (such as Yardi or AppFolio), Microsoft Office, and basic accounting tools is typically required. Excellent communication, customer service, and problem-solving abilities help you effectively interact with tenants, vendors, and property managers. These skills ensure smooth operations, tenant satisfaction, and efficient support of property management teams.

What are some typical challenges a property management assistant faces and how can they be addressed?

Property Management Assistants often juggle a variety of tasks, such as handling tenant inquiries, coordinating maintenance requests, and maintaining accurate records. A common challenge is managing competing priorities, especially during busy rental seasons or when dealing with urgent property issues. Effective organization, strong communication skills, and the ability to remain calm under pressure are essential to successfully navigate these situations. Proactive planning and leveraging property management software can also help streamline daily responsibilities.

What is the difference between Property Management Assistant vs Leasing Coordinator?

AspectProperty Management AssistantLeasing Coordinator
CredentialsBasic administrative skills, sometimes real estate license or certificationReal estate license often required, strong customer service skills
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, supporting property managersOffice and on-site visits, focusing on leasing activities
Employer & IndustryProperty management companies, real estate firmsReal estate agencies, property leasing firms
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ding support roles in property managementFocus on leasing and tenant acquisition

While both roles support property operations, a Property Management Assistant primarily handles administrative tasks across various property functions, whereas a Leasing Coordinator specializes in tenant leasing processes and lease negotiations. The roles often overlap but serve different aspects of property management and leasing operations.
